Franklin County schools ranked by test score
Latest TCAP year (2024-25). 12 schools in Franklin County, Tennessee with reported English Language Arts scores. Tennessee state average: 40.9%.
| Rank | School | Level | English Language Arts | vs state |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Sewanee Elementary Sewanee · Franklin County | Elementary | 76.0% | +35.1pp |
| 2 | Broadview Elementary Winchester · Franklin County | Elementary | 51.4% | +10.5pp |
| 3 | Franklin Co High School Winchester · Franklin County | High | 42.9% | +2.0pp |
| 4 | North Lake Elementary Tullahoma · Franklin County | Elementary | 40.8% | -0.1pp |
| 5 | Cowan Elementary Cowan · Franklin County | Elementary | 35.0% | -5.9pp |
| 6 | Huntland School Huntland · Franklin County | Combined | 34.5% | -6.4pp |
| 7 | Clark Memorial School Winchester · Franklin County | Elementary | 34.0% | -6.9pp |
| 8 | West Middle School Tullahoma · Tullahoma | Middle | 29.6% | -11.3pp |
| 9 | Rock Creek Elementary Estill Springs · Franklin County | Elementary | 25.4% | -15.5pp |
| 10 | South Middle School Cowan · Franklin County | Middle | 23.6% | -17.3pp |
| 11 | Decherd Elementary Decherd · Franklin County | Elementary | 22.4% | -18.5pp |
| 12 | North Middle School Winchester · Franklin County | Middle | 20.7% | -20.2pp |
About this ranking
Schools are ranked by the percentage of students who scored at or above the TCAP % On Track or Mastered threshold on the latest available TCAP English Language Arts test (school year 2024-25). Only public schools in Franklin County, Tennessee with a reasonable cohort size are shown. A higher percentage is better.
